About George Washington Elementary Sch

George Washington Elementary Sch is a public elementary school in East Chicago, IN, part of School City of East Chicago. George Washington Elementary Sch serves approximately 413 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-6th, and has a 15.9:1 student-teacher ratio. George Washington Elementary Sch has a current MySchoolScout rating of 2.6 out of 10 and ranks #1,795 of 1,823 schools in IN.

Structured state assessment records for George Washington Elementary Sch show 33%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025) and 36%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025).

What Parents Should Know

39% of students at George Washington Elementary Sch were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
